The Overall Health Score in 39563, Moss Point, Mississippi is 6 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
84.41 percent of the population in 39563 drive to work alone. 0.04 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 75.43 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 2.24 percent of the residents in 39563 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.14 members with about 2.07 cars available per household.
An estimate of 80.56 percent of the residents in 39563 has some form of health insurance. 41.34 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 52.17 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 39563 would have to travel an average of 4.26 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Singing River Health System . In a 20-mile radius, there are 443 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 39563, Moss Point, Mississippi.

As of , an estimate of 12,259 residents live in 39563 with a median age of 41.8 years. 21.52 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 18.92 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.90 percent of the residents in 39563 is currently married, and 26.47 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 39563 is $4,641.58.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 39563 is approximately $677. The median household spends about 14.59 percent of their income on housing.

Moss Point, Mississippi has a fascinating history that dates back to the early 18th century when it was inhabited by Native American tribes. The city's proximity to the Pascagoula River made it an attractive location for settlers, leading to its incorporation in 1901. Over the years, Moss Point has grown into a vibrant community known for its southern charm and welcoming atmosphere.
When it comes to healthcare amenities, Moss Point offers several options for residents. Singing River Health System is a prominent healthcare provider in the area, offering a range of services including primary care, specialty care, and emergency services. The health system operates Singing River Hospital and Ocean Springs Hospital, providing convenient access to quality healthcare for individuals in Moss Point and the surrounding areas.
In addition to traditional healthcare facilities, Moss Point is also home to several community health initiatives aimed at promoting wellness and accessibility. The Moss Point Active Living Center is a hub for health and wellness activities tailored to older adults in the community. The center offers fitness classes, health screenings, and social gatherings to support the overall well-being of its members.
